05/03/2018 – Flaketop

E. Marquez will lead "Flaketop" with a duration of 2.5 hours somewwhere in The Chugach Front Range.

Meet at 6:15 p.m. at the corner of Upper De Armoun road and Canyon road.  We will carpool to the trailhead for a 6:30 start.  We will proceed to Flattop and continue along the ridge to Flaketop, and return via the main trail.

01/04/2018 – Peak 3

E. Marquez will lead "Peak 3" with a duration of 3 hours somewwhere in The Chugach Front Range.

Meet at 6:15 at the intersection of Upper DeArmoun and Canyon roads.  We will carpool to the Rabbit Lake trailhead for a 6:30 start.  We will climb to the top of Flattop, then follow the ridge to Peak 3 and return.  Microspikes and ice axe may be necessary.

10/26/2017 – The Long Road to Recovery

Lee Helzer will lead "The Long Road to Recovery" with a duration of 3 hours somewwhere in The Chugach Front Range.

At 6:30 we will depart from Upper O’Malley trailhead by Shebanof Ave. and Stroganof Dr.

This will be my first Epic back and longest hike to date after my knee injury.  The first half of the Epic will be a slow and cautious walk up the Gasline trail linking to the Powerline trail via the Hemlock Knob trail.  Once we reach the Glen Alps cut off, I will depart as my knee currently only allows for uphill travel.

Those remaining will step up the pace and jog the Middle Fork trail to a weather/participant dependent creek crossing and exciting bushwhack back to the Rim trail.  A series of trails will link runners back to the Upper O’Malley trailhead.
